    Justin Rose set to miss cut at Zurich classic of New Orleans

    World number 10 Justin Rose will have to wait to see if he has missed the cut at the Zurich Classic of New Orleans after two level par rounds.

    The Englishman's fate rests in the balance after the second round was suspended due to bad light, with the projected cut standing at two under.

    Zurich Classic: 3rd round suspended for the day

    The 2016 Zurich Classic of New Orleans will finish the second round on Saturday before trying to complete the third round in the same day after the cut.Â

    The cut was 2-under and 82 players made the cut. The third round will begin at noon.Â

    Some big names missed cut including defenire ng champion Justin Rose (even) and former LSU golfer Smylie Kaufman (5-over).Â

    Winner's bag: Brian Stuard, Zurich Classic of New Orleans

    Athough it took five days to play three rounds (plus a little overtime), Brian Stuard notched his first PGA Tour win at the Zurich Classic of New Orleans thanks to some superb work on the greens. In addition to making all 40 of his attempts inside 10 feet, Stuard led the field at 2.849 in strokes gained/putting. Stuard used an Odyssey Works Marxman Fang Tank counterbalanced putter, a club he first put in play last week at the Valero Texas Open. In a nod to the fickleness some players can have with the putter, Stuard did not endure extensive testing, but rather simply pulled the club from the demo bag by the practice green in Texas, rolled a few putts with it and decided to put it in play. The putter is 35 inches in length.
